Giglio Castello, Tuscany, Italy
Overview
Giglio Castello is a picturesque medieval hilltop village on Giglio Island in Tuscany. Renowned for its impressive stone fortress and winding streets, it offers stunning panoramic views and authentic island life in a tranquil setting. With its small population, the town remains charming, intimate, and rich in tradition.
Best Time to Visit
April-June and September-October for mild weather and fewer tourists.
Local Tips
Pack comfortable shoes for hilly, cobbled streets and bring cash as some shops and restaurants may not accept cards. Ferries run to the island from Porto Santo Stefano.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ping is modest but appreciated (round up or leave small change). Casual dress is fine; shoulders should be covered in churches. Greet locals with a friendly 'Buongiorno'.
Safety Warnings
Giglio Castello is exceptionally safe; exercise caution on steep pathways and castle steps, especially when wet. No known scams or areas to avoid.
Hidden Gems
Climb the castle tower for sunset views, visit the local wine cellars, and seek out hiking trails to secluded lookouts along the village's ancient walls.
